ICC World Cup | Ben Stokes ‘in a good place’ as he targets return for England vs. South Africa

Posted on October 19, 2023 By admin
ICC World Cup | Ben Stokes ‘in a good place’ as he targets return for England vs. South Africa

England’s Ben Stokes during practice. | Photo Credit: REUTERS Ben Stokes declared himself ready Thursday to play in England’s crucial Cricket World Cup match against South Africa after missing the first three games because of injury. Stokes, the match-winner in the 2019 final, has been struggling with a hip problem sustained a week before the…

Mathews, Chameera to join Sri Lankan squad as travelling reserves

Posted on October 19, 2023 By admin
Mathews, Chameera to join Sri Lankan squad as travelling reserves

Sri Lanka’s Angelo Mathews. | Photo Credit: AFP Veteran all-rounder Angelo Mathews and pacer Dushmantha Chameera will join Sri Lanka’s World Cup squad in Lucknow on Friday as travelling reserves, country’s cricket board announced on Thursday. Both Mathews and Chameera last played in an ODI series against Afghanistan in June. The 36-year-old Mathews is a…
